Executive Director
Camp of the Hills Mission Statement: Create space and invitation to see, hear, know and experience God.
For over three decades, Camp of the Hills has been a place of transformation, providing hope and restoration through Christ-centered ministry serving low-income, at-risk and underserved children. This is for an executive leader to step in and build upon a deeply rooted legacy.

Core Responsibilities:
- Provide operational leadership to uphold and advance Camp of the Hills’ mission.
- Engage in fundraising, donor development, and financial oversight, managing a seven-figure budget with transparency and excellence.
- Oversee strategic planning, goal setting, KPIs, and accountability measures to ensure ministry effectiveness.
- Manage and develop staff with an emphasis on team dynamics, professional growth, and organizational health.
- Spearhead capital projects, working with contractors, securing funding, and executing plans effectively.
- Optimizing camp assets and resources to generate revenue and serve the broader community outside of the summer camp season.
- Serve as the primary liaison to the board of directors, fostering alignment between governance and operations.
Preferred Experience & Qualifications:
- Proven leadership experience in a Christian camp, nonprofit/ministry or corporate setting.
- Pastoral or discipleship background, demonstrating a history of relational, Christ-centered leadership.
- Strong financial management skills, including budgeting, cash-flow analysis, and board reporting.
- Master-site plan oversight experience, from fundraising to construction management.
